A recurring theme is the importance of fostering intrinsic motivation. Current systems rely heavily on external rewards and punishments, which can diminish authentic engagement. Instead, educators are exploring Choice Theory—empowering students to select projects aligned with their passions.
Project-Based Learning (PBL) exemplifies this approach, allowing students to undertake meaningful, self-directed projects. For instance, a middle schooler designed a VR exposure therapy app, demonstrating how student-driven work taps into intrinsic interests and leads to deeper learning.
